Lisanti Capital Growth LLC increased its position in Calix, Inc (NYSE:CALX – Free Report) by 17.7% in the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 95,736 shares of the communications equipment provider’s stock after buying an additional 14,415 shares during the period. Lisanti Capital Growth LLC owned about 0.14% of Calix worth $5,067,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Calix (NYSE:CALX –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, April 21st. The communications equipment provider reported $0.40 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.37 by $0.03. Calix had a net margin of 3.20% and a return on equity of 4.30%. The firm had revenue of $279.98 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$277.50 million. During the same quarter in the prior year, the business posted $0.19 earnings per share. Calix’s revenue for the quarter was up 27.2% compared to the same quarter last year. Calix has set its Q2 2026 guidance at 0.350-0.450 EPS. As a group, equities analysts forecast that Calix, Inc will post 0.85 EPS for the current fiscal year.
Calix announced that its board has initiated a stock repurchase program on Wednesday, January 28th that allows the company to repurchase $125.00 million in shares. This repurchase authorization allows the communications equipment provider to reacquire up to 3.4% of its shares through open market purchases. Calix Profile
Calix, Inc is a provider of cloud and software platforms, systems, and services that enable broadband service providers to transform their networks and subscriber experiences. The company’s flagship Calix Cloud platform delivers real-time analytics, automation and intelligence designed to simplify network operations, improve service agility and drive revenue growth. Calix also offers a comprehensive suite of premises and access systems, including broadband access nodes, fiber-to-the-home optics and residential gateways under the GigaSpire brand.
Through its software-defined network architecture, Calix helps service providers virtualize key network functions and introduce new services with minimal capital expenditure.
